The molecules of the acidic polysaccharide produced by the bacterium Bradyrhizobium (Chamaecytisus) BGA-1 were associated when dissolved in water, but not when dissolved in KCl, Ca2Cl or EDTA solutions. We have found no proof of divalent cation-mediated binding of the poly- saccharide molecules. The polymerisation degree of the basic pentasaccharide unit was determined by chromatography in Sephacryl HR400 with lineal dextran molecules used as molecular weight standards. It ranged between 26 to 105 repeating units, being more frequent the molecules made by 43-44 pentasaccharides.
